The last education policy was framed in 1986 and revised in 1992, and had not been revised since then. The new policy is as per BJP's election manifesto and therefore there could be bravado by BJP and condemnation by Congress and other opposition parties, in the coming days.

However, we have to remember that this new policy is drafted by a committee of eminent scientists, educationists, and leading experts in the relevant fields. My ISRO colleagues can be very proud of this achievement as the Committee is headed by former ISRO Chairman Dr K Kasturirangan.


The National Education Policy 2020 document, as published by the new Ministry of Education, is just 60 pages and contains all the relevant details. However, it misses the meat of the policy since I feel that the most important elements are in the 17-page Preamble of the 'Draft National Education Policy 2019' document that consists of 484 pages.

The following sub-headings of the Preamble will give you the essence of the policy:

  • The Journey of the Committee
  • A vision for the education system in India
  • Drawing from India’s heritage
  • Taking forward the agenda of previous education policies
  • Alignment with the global sustainable development goals
  • An integrated yet flexible approach to education
  • Liberal arts approach in higher education
  • Focus on high quality research
  • Facilitating transformation of the education system
  • Facilitating national development
  • Ensuring implementation in spirit and intent
  • A note of gratitude
In the Preamble, Dr Kasturirangan presents the various factors and thought processes that went into the making of the policy document. He briefly introduces each member of the National Education Policy Committee, the background and expertise of each member, and the specific contributions each made. He goes on to mention that the Committee sought the views of some of the leading thinkers in education in this country, who served as peer reviewers of the document.
